Bob the Builder On The Road
Bob the Builder will be on the road as never before, with visits to the popular Day Out With Thomas 2007: All Aboard Tour and new dates for his critically-acclaimed museum tour. In a 20-minute performance, at the Day Out With Thomas Tour, Bob the Builder will ask for the help of aspiring Can-Do Crew members to build a shed for Thomas to sleep in while he's visiting the railroad. The Day Out With Thomas 2007: All Aboard Tour is an annual fun-filled event that offers preschoolers and their families the opportunity to take a ride on a 15-ton replica of Thomas the Tank Engine, and enjoy lots of additional Thomas-themed entertainment.
In June 2006, the first-ever hands-on Bob the Builder - Project: Build It Traveling Museum Exhibit debuted at the Children's Museum of Indianapolis. Inspired by the top rated television series, Bob the Builder - Project: Build It, the exhibit replicates elements from Bob the Builder's world in Sunflower Valley inviting exploration, inspiring teamwork and bringing building themes to life for children and families. With visits to 30 major markets in North America through 2011, the 2,000 square-foot exhibit will reach more than 2 million children and families. The Bob the Builder - Project: Build It Traveling Museum Exhibit is currently at the Minnesota Children's Museum in St. Paul, Minnesota until April 22, 2007 and the Children's Museum of Seattle until May 21, 2007.

About HIT Entertainment
HIT Entertainment, owned by private equity investment group Apax Partners since June 2005, is one of the world’s leading independent children’s entertainment producers and rights-owners. HIT’s portfolio includes internationally renowned children’s properties, such as Bob the Builder™, Barney™, Thomas & Friends™, Pingu™, Rubbadubbers™ and Angelina Ballerina™. HIT acts as a representative for The Wiggles® in the UK, US and Canada and as worldwide representative for The Jim Henson Company’s library of classic family brands, including Fraggle Rock™. HIT also owns the Guinness World Records™ publishing and television property and Fireman Sam™, a joint venture with S4C. Launched in 1989, HIT’s lines of business span television and video production (including studios in the US and the UK), publishing, consumer products licensing and live events. With a catalog of more than 1,000 hours of young children’s programming, HIT sells its shows to more than 240 countries worldwide, in more than 40 different languages and has operations in the UK, US, Canada, Hong Kong and Japan. In 2005, the Company joined Comcast Corporation, PBS and Sesame Workshop to launch PBS KIDS Sprout℠, a 24-hour digital cable channel and VOD service for preschoolers.
